Didouche Mourad Cement Plant is a cement plant in Algeria with a reported capacity of 1,000,000 t of cement. It burns limestone in high-temperature rotary kilns to make clinker and cement. It is operated by Societe Des Ciments De Hamma Bouziane SpA. By capacity it ranks #13 of 16 cement plants tracked in Algeria. It emits about 239,687 tonnes of CO₂e per year (Climate TRACE) — roughly the tailpipe emissions of 55,871 cars. Its CO₂ per unit of capacity is about 33% below the median cement plant.
